Tariq Jafer, Razī: Master of Qurʾanic Interpretation and Theological Reasoning
F akhr al-Dīn al-Rāzī (d. 606/1209) has been the subject of much recent scholarship that has afrmed his importance as an innovative thinker, who had a hand in advancing the many disciplines in which he wrote. Tariq Jafer’s new book stands on the shoulders of long-standing work by the likes of Ignaz Goldziher and Josef van Ess, as well as scholars who have recently written on al-Rāzī including Ayman Shihadeh and Michel Lagarde. Jafer adds valuable insights to the available work on this towering fgure in Islamic intellectual history.
